  1. Materials:
  • Clear glass or plastic jar with lid
  • Water
  • Food coloring
  • Baking soda
  • Vinegar
  • Measuring spoons
  • Funnel (optional)
  • Stirring stick or spoon
  • Tissues or paper towel (for cleanup)
  1. Full Step-by-Step

Preparation:

  • Start by gathering all your materials. Ensure your workspace is covered to catch any spills.

Step 1: Mix the Base

  • Fill your jar about halfway with water.
  • Add several drops of food coloring. Swirl gently to mix until the water is colored.

Step 2: Add Baking Soda

  • Using a measuring spoon, add about 1-2 tablespoons of baking soda to the colored water.
  • Stir well to combine. Notice the fizzing action as the baking soda interacts with the water.

Step 3: Prepare for the Reaction

  • Using a funnel (if needed), carefully pour about 1-2 tablespoons of vinegar into the jar.
  • Watch closely! The mixture will start to bubble and foam as the reaction occurs, creating a colorful explosion.

Step 4: Enjoy the Show

  • Observe the fizzing and the vibrant colors mixing together. Listen to the sound of the bubbles as they rise and pop.

  1. Frequently Asked Questions:

Q1: Can I use any jar?
A1: Yes, just ensure it’s clear to view the reaction. Glass jars are great for visual impact, but plastic also works.

Q2: What if I don’t have vinegar?
A2: You can try lemon juice or citric acid, as they provide similar acidic properties.

Q3: How can I clean up after the activity?
A3: Use tissues or paper towels to clean spills quickly. The ingredients are non-toxic and easy to wash.

Q4: Is this safe for children?
A4: Yes, the materials used are non-toxic, making it safe for supervised play. Just ensure they understand not to ingest any of the ingredients.
